中文摘要:
      【】目的:探讨分析胸腔积液ESR、TGF-β1、IL-27对结核性胸膜炎预后的评估价值。方法:选择2021年3月~2023年3月我院收治的184例结核性胸膜炎患者,根据患者治疗预后情况将患者分为预后良好组(n=146)、预后不良组(n=38)。收集并记录两组患者临床资料,并检测比较两组患者胸腔积液ESR、TGF-β1、IL-27水平,对可能影响患者临床预后的各因素进行单因素及多因素Logistic回归分析,采用ROC曲线分析患者胸腔积液ESR、TGF-β1、IL-27水平对不良预后预测价值。结果:两组临床资料比较,性别、糖尿病、高血压以及冠心病比较差异无统计学意义(P>0.05),而两组患者年龄、就诊时间、胸水细胞数、胸水蛋白总量比较差异具有统计学意义(P<0.05)。预后不良组患者胸腔积液ESR、TGF-β1、IL-27水平均显著高于预后良好组(P<0.05)。多因素Logistic回归分析结果显示,胸腔积液ESR、TGF-β1、IL-27以及胸水细胞数、胸水蛋白总量进入回归模型(P<0.05)。采用ROC曲线分析患者胸腔积液ESR、TGF-β1、IL-27水平对不良预后的预测价值,曲线下面积分别为0.787、0.852、0.892(P<0.05)。结论:结核性胸膜炎患者胸腔积液ESR、TGF-β1、IL-27可在一定程度上预测患者治疗预后,从而为患者病情评估以及治疗效果的评估提供一定的参考价值,值得临床进一步深入研究分析。
英文摘要:
      Objective: To evaluate the prognostic value of pleural effusion ESR, TGF-β1 and IL-27 in tuberculous pleurisy. Methods: 184 patients with tuberculous pleurisy admitted to our hospital from March 2021 to March 2023 were selected and divided into good prognosis group (n=146) and poor prognosis group (n=38) according to the treatment and prognosis of the patients. Clinical data of the two groups of patients were collected and recorded, and the levels of ESR, TGF-β1 and IL-27 in pleural effusion of the two groups were measured and compared. Univariate and multivariate Logistic regression analysis was performed for various factors that may affect the clinical prognosis of the patients. ROC curve was used to analyze the predictive value of ESR, TGF-β1 and IL-27 in patients with pleural effusion. Results: There were no statistically significant differences in clinical data between the two groups in gender, diabetes, hypertension and coronary heart disease (P>0.05), but there were statistically significant differences in age, treatment time, number of pleural fluid cells and total pleural fluid protein between the two groups (P<0.05). The levels of ESR, TGF-β1 and IL-27 in pleural effusion in poor prognosis group were significantly higher than those in good prognosis group (P<0.05). Multivariate Logistic regression analysis showed that ESR, TGF-β1, IL-27, the number of pleural effusion cells and total pleural effusion protein entered the regression model (P<0.05). ROC curve was used to analyze the predictive value of ESR, TGF-β1 and IL-27 in patients with pleural effusion, and the areas under the curve were 0.787, 0.852 and 0.892, respectively (P<0.05). Conclusion: ESR, TGF-β1, and IL-27 in pleural effusion of patients with tuberculous pleurisy can predict the prognosis of patients to a certain extent, thus providing certain reference value for the evaluation of patients" condition and treatment effect, which is worthy of further clinical research and analysis.
